What to know about ZIP 78552

ZIP code 78552 covers Harlingen, TX in Cameron County with a population of about 41,277.

At a glance, the area shows median age of 33.1 versus a U.S. median of about 38.9.

It sits in telephone area code 956; U.S. House district TX-34; the HARLINGEN - WSLCO - BRNSVL - MCA media market.

Income and economy in Harlingen, TX

Median household income in ZIP 78552 is about $67,183 — about 11% below the U.S. median ($75,149).

On socioeconomic markers, US5 shows a poverty rate of 20.6%; unemployment rate near 5.4%; 21.9% of adults with a bachelor’s degree or higher (about 11.8 points below the national share (33.7%)).

Labor and commute patterns include leading industry context around Healthcare, Education, and Retail trade; about 10.2% of workers reporting work-from-home (about 5.0 points below the U.S. share (15.2%)); a mean commute of about 180.0 minutes (U.S. average near 26.8).

Housing and affordability in ZIP 78552

Median home value is about $154,500 — about 56% below the U.S. median home value ($348,079).

Housing tenure and rents show median gross rent around $774 (about 33% below the U.S. median rent ($1,163)), and owner-occupancy near 74.7% (about 9.3 points above the national owner-occupancy rate (65.4%)).

Climate risk and migration signals

FEMA’s National Risk Index rates natural-hazard risk for Harlingen city, TX as Relatively High (composite score 97.3), which is among the highest nationally. The strongest component scores on US5 are hurricane (99.0) and flood (92.8). These scores are county-linked NRI values published for planning context — all ZIP codes in the same county share the same composite score on US5. Useful when comparing insurance and disaster exposure across areas, not a substitute for a parcel-level flood or fire determination.

Climate normals for Harlingen city, TX show little to no average snow and around 28.2 inches of annual precipitation.
